My roof was installed when the house was built around 2015. What kind of shape is it likely in now?

An 11-year-old architectural asphalt shingle roof on 7/16-inch OSB decking in Highland Park is entering its critical phase. The Colorado sun's UV radiation degrades the shingle granule layer each summer, while freeze-thaw cycles in winter compromise the sealant strips. This combination accelerates granule loss and can cause the OSB decking beneath to swell if moisture infiltrates past the compromised shingles. We often see the first significant failures on south- and west-facing slopes at this age.

What does 'wind zone' and 'impact rating' mean for my roof replacement here?

Stepping Stone's building code enforces design for 115 mph 3-second gust winds (ASCE 7-22). This requires specific nailing patterns, adhesive application, and drip edge details. For hail, which is frequent from May through August, UL 2218 Class 4 shingles are a financial necessity. They withstand 2-inch steel ball impacts, drastically reducing the probability of damage from our average hailstorms. Using them is often the threshold for securing those valuable insurance credits.

A roofer did a visual inspection and said my roof is fine, but I'm still concerned. What are they missing?

A traditional walk-over inspection cannot see sub-surface moisture trapped within the roofing layers or the OSB deck. AI-enhanced drone thermal moisture mapping identifies these problem areas by detecting temperature differentials caused by wet insulation or decking. This technology is critical for pinpointing failing sections before interior ceilings show stains, allowing for targeted repairs that address the root cause, not just the visible symptom.

My homeowner's insurance premium just jumped again. Can a new roof actually lower my bill?

Yes, directly. Colorado insurers are applying a 28% average premium trend, heavily factoring in roof age and storm resilience. Installing an IBHS FORTIFIED Home-certified roof system makes you eligible for significant discounts, as it demonstrably reduces the insurer's risk. The program's enhanced requirements for deck attachment, sealed roof edges, and impact-resistant shingles translate into fewer and smaller claims, which your carrier rewards with a lower annual premium.

My attic gets extremely hot and I'm worried about mold. Could the roof itself be the cause?

Absolutely. A 4/12 pitch roof in our climate requires a balanced ventilation system per the 2021 IRC, as amended locally in 2024. Inadequate intake (soffit vents) or exhaust (ridge vents) creates a stagnant, superheated attic. This bakes the shingles from underneath, shortening their life, and leads to condensation on the cold OSB deck in winter, promoting mold growth. Proper ventilation is a non-negotiable component of a healthy, durable roof assembly.

I'm considering solar. Should I replace my old shingles first, or install solar shingles?

With current net metering and the 30% federal investment tax credit, the economics favor traditional photovoltaic panels installed on a new, high-quality architectural shingle roof. This separates the functions: a robust, maintainable weather barrier (the roof) from the energy-producing asset (the panels). Integrated solar shingles, while aesthetically clean, can complicate repairs and may not match the impact resistance or longevity of dedicated, Class 4-rated asphalt shingles in our high-hail environment.

What are the key legal and code requirements I need to know for a roof replacement in 2026?

All work requires a permit from the Douglas County Building Division and must be performed by a contractor licensed by Colorado DORA. The 2021 IRC with local 2024 amendments dictates specific material and installation standards. For Stepping Stone, this includes mandatory ice and water shield along eaves and in valleys, and upgraded flashing details at walls and penetrations. These code-minimums are the baseline; the FORTIFIED standard and Class 4 shingles we recommend exceed them for greater durability and insurability.
